Researchers have developed a novel Bi-Anchor Interpolation Solver (BA-solver) to accelerate generative modeling, specifically addressing the latency issues in Flow Matching (FM) models. The BA-solver utilizes a lightweight SideNet alongside a frozen backbone to learn future and historical velocities, enabling efficient approximation of intermediate velocities. This approach allows for high-precision generation with significantly fewer Neural Function Evaluations (NFEs) compared to traditional methods, achieving comparable quality to solvers requiring over 100 NFEs in as few as 10 NFEs.
